Four basic rules for safe gun use

Probably well known to many on this forum, but these are the four basic rules of safe gun use given to me by a Deputy Sheriff friend of mine in the US.  I thought it worth writing them down as they have stood the test of time..

Always presume a gun is loaded unless you have checked it yourself.
Always know your target and what is behind it.
Never point your gun at something you do not intent to shoot.
Never put your finger on the trigger before you are ready to fire.

He also then added one of his own which I liked..

Always know the whereabouts of your gun and who has access to it.

Hope these are of some use, if you have better please feel free to add..

An add line to go with "Never put your finger on the trigger unless you are going to fire"....
Never rely on the safety on your gun

We are taught these rules in our Hunter Safety Classes.
Over here in the USA...
